During the attack on Kyiv, 41-year-old police colonel Yuriy Zaskoka was killed. He was on his way to work at the time of the impact.

The relevant information was provided by the police. It is known that the law enforcement officer was just on Shevchenko Boulevard, where the Russians ended up. cke-markup”>Russian missiles killed 11 people. Among them is Yuriy Zaskoka, 41-year-old police colonel, head of the Cyber ​​Police Department. At the time of the strike, the policeman was driving along Shevchenko Boulevard to work, the police said.

According to the police, Yuriy was the head of the critical infrastructure protection department. He devoted almost 24 years to his work in the police.

Unfortunately, two children were left without a father.

As a result of the attack on Kyiv there are dead and wounded

As a result of the attack on Kyiv, adviser to the Minister of Internal Affairs Rostyslav Smirnov said that 8 people were killed in the Shevchenkovsky district. Another 24 Ukrainian civilians were injured.

There was a fire of 6 cars and more than 15 cars were damaged. 30 people and 6 pieces of equipment of the State Emergency Service were involved. The information is being clarified,” Smirnov noted.

Subsequently, Svetlana Vodolaga, a spokeswoman for the State Emergency Service, said that as a result of a massive attack in Kyiv:

  • 6 people were killed;
  • 50 more were injured;
  • 12 were saved.
